Resident Evil Netflix series cancelled after one season
Lance Reddick deserved better
Netflix launched their Resident Evil TV series just a few week back, and it was absolutely bombarded with negative reviews. It was rather hard to find good press out there, and even tougher to track down positive reviews from the general public. It seems that negative word of mouth spread far and wide, as Netflix has now officially pulled the plug on the series.
If you were hoping to see what happens with Wesker and the gang going forward, you’ll have to take the fan fiction route. Netflix has confirmed that Resident Evil is officially canceled, making the debut season the send-off as well. The final nail in the coffin was likely the fact that Resident Evil fell out of Netflix’s top 10 shows after just 3 weeks on the charts.
Just to put things into perspective a little bit more, Resident Evil received a 55% from critics on Rotten Tomatoes and a 27% audience score. Not exactly glowing numbers, and a situation where the audience was sure to drop for a follow-up season if one got made.
